Ryoto knew he had to find allies. He started going around villages, asking if anyone shared the same opinions as Ryoto and if they were willing to join him.

So far he found 5 loyal dragons. He found Diaval first. He was a jet-black dragon, with piercing amber eyes. He strongly despised the Great Lunar War. He wished there were no deaths. Afterwards, he found Firnen. The dark-green dragon was Saphira's brother. He was devastated after learning that Saphira had been murdered. He wanted to avenge his sister's death. Then he saw Longwei. The pink dragon had hated Haru and Lord Kaito ever since they were crowned. She wanted to rip them apart with her claws. Then he befriended Haku. The white dragon with a light spring green mane. Haku felt sorry for all of the Lunar Dragons. His grandmother had been a Lunar Dragon, and had been murdered. He also wanted to avenge his grandmother's death. And finally, he met Leviathan. He was a giant, silver and dark-blue dragon. He had control of the water. He wanted to wipe the leaders off the planet.

Ryoto knew that he would need an entire army. He asked the five dragons to gather up the dragons that wanted to join. They agreed immediately.

Day after day, his father sent many generals to fetch Ryoto. First he sent General Attor. Then he sent General Maleficent. Then General Chua. They were all killed by Haru's very own claws.

Ryoto grew restless. He needed the army. He needed to overthrow Lord Kaito and his own father, Haru. Even though he was just a small dragonet, he had a great dream—a dream not like Lord Kaito's or his father's.

He paced by his den, breathing heavily. Kato watched him with curious eyes. Ryoto knew that the deaths of Dagahra, Attor, Maleficent, and Chua were all his fault. And they were all murdered by his own father.

He wanted to rip his father's handsome face into shreds.

He wanted to slash Lord Kaito's perfect neck.

He wanted them to die.

The more he thought about his revenge, the more excited he got. He was going to make them pay for all of the Lunar Dragons. His mother, Dagagra, Attor, Maleficent, and Chua.

"Lord Ryoto!" A dragon bounded up. Rhaegal, her dark-green scales shimmering in light, stopped by his side. Rhaegal was Dagahra's sister. Rhaegal followed Ryoto immediately. "We just recruited Coatl, Dracul, and Thorn."

The three dragons stepped up. Ryoto nodded to each dragon. "We need all of your help to overthrow the government," Ryoto told them.

Thorn raised his red talon up. "Lord Ryoto, we need a strategist, a messenger, and all of those roles. This way, we can win the war."

Dracul nodded his black head. "Yes, Lord Ryoto. I have a few dragons I can name to help you."

Coatl's gray-silver scales flashed as he spoke. "We completely support you, Lord Ryoto."

Ryoto smiled weakly. "Thank you. Who do you think should be our strategist?"

Dracul said, "I have three dragons' names in mind. I think Drago, the great dragon of the skies, could be the strategist. He knows the ground by heart, after flying in the skies for such a long time. He is wise. Then there's Uruloki. His mind is as sharp as knives, able to penetrate the veil of secrets. And finally, Drakon. Drakon is Drago's twin, and he has studied Strategy in his life."

Ryoto tried to choose, but he couldn't. "How about this: all three of them could be the Strategists. Dracul, could you go fetch them?"

Dracul dipped his head and flew away.

"Right, Lord Ryoto, I remembered something," Rhaegal piped up. "Haru and Kaito have loyal supporters. They are: Arman, Shenron, and Shenlong."

Ryoto's face darkened. "Arman? Arman came to talk to me a few days ago about coming to the palace. He even started to ask me about my alliance... Oh no!" Ryoto gasped, clutching his head. "I didn't realize that he was loyal to Lord Kaito! He must've revealed my rebellion to Kaito! He's coming after me!"

The dragons shared an uneasy look. If Arman revealed their secret, they were doomed.

Leviathan's dark-blue mane quivered. "Don't worry," he boomed in his deep voice. "We'll make sure we pick off every single one of them."

Firnen nodded. "I will never forgive Haru and Kaito for this. For murdering my sister..." He sighed as he thought of Saphira. "We need a plan."

Ryoto sighed as he opened a scroll. He announced, "all of the rebellion! Come to me right now so I can see who's here."

The crowd of dragons pressed in closer, and Ryoto started calling out the names: "Diaval?"

"Here!"

"Firnen!"

"Here!"

"Longwei!"

"Here!"

"Haku!"

"Here!"

"Leviathan!"

"Here!"

After all of the dragons were settled, Kato flew in. He spread his magnificent wings and rested down on Ryoto's shoulder. He sang beautifully before touching his beak to every dragon's forehead.

"We need a plan to get Lord Kaito and Haru— my own father— to bow to us. Any ideas?"

"We need to— hey, isn't that Shenron?" Longwei gasped, pointing up to a flying green dragon. The dragon gaped, and tried to fly away.

"Leviathan!" Ryoto whirled towards the massive dragon, and Leviathan raised his talons. Water from a nearby lake rocketed up, making an arch in the air, and slammed straight into the dragon's chest. The dragon flailed, but fell down to the ground.

Ryoto's heart was beating as he ran towards the fallen dragon. "Haku, Firnen, Coatl, Thorn. Please hold him down."

As the four dragons obeyed, the dragon started sputtering, water flying out of his snout.

Longwei snarled, "this idiotic dragon here is Shenron, twin to Shenlong, loyal supporter to Haru."

Shenron writhed, hissing, but the dragons held him still. "Let me go! I'm here to retrieve General Haru's son! It's an order!"

Rhaegal slammed his snout shut. "You cold-hearted dragon! Haru only wants Ryoto because he wants to kill him!"

"He knows that you have a rebellion! You're going to regret it! I'd advise you to move and return back to your normal lives!" Shenron's eyes gleamed angrily.

Diaval snarled, steam rising out of his nostrils. "You are supporting the wrong side! Haru is the cause of all of these deaths! The deaths of all of the Lunar Dragons!"

"The Lunar Dragons are evil! They are dirty-blooded dragons! They have ruined our entire generation!"

"You're wrong," Ryoto snarled. "Haru and Kaito have, not us. If you support them, then you're also going to ruin our generation."

Shenron only huffed, a coil of smoke rising into the air.

The rest of the dragons looked at Ryoto, waiting for their next order. The sound of wingbeats frightened them, and when they looked up, they saw Dracul returning with three dragons. When Dracul saw Shenron, his eyes narrowed.

When the dragons landed, Ryoto thanked Dracul. Then he turned to the three dragons. "Hello, welcome to the rebellion. I'm Ryoto, the leader of this army. Our objective is to kill Haru and Kaito, and make them pay for what they did to the Lunar Dragons."

Uruloki nodded. "I understand, Lord Ryoto."

Drakon and Drago nodded. "Lord Ryoto, we will help you. We will join your ranks."

Ryoto smiled and hugged them. "Thank you so much. First, we need a plan on what to do first."

"Uhm, Lord Ryoto, what do we do with Shenron?" Coatl called. He was holding Shenron's twitching talons. Kato perched on Shenron's torso, pecking him whenever he moved.

Ryoto hesitated and said, "tie him up. We'll keep him hostage. We can't kill him. He might be a useful pawn."

Shenron snorted. "So you're just going to keep me hostage and go make General Haru and Lord Kaito scared? Hm." He tried to jerk away, but the dragons held tight.

"But where do we hold him?" Ryoto looked around at his surroundings.

"Ah, Lord Ryoto, I found a chain of underground tunnels when I went exploring around here recently," Haku admitted. He said, "we could hold dragons there. We have taloncuffs and silencers."

"Excellent!" Ryoto exclaimed. He turned to the dragons. "Haku and Firnen, bring our guest here to the cages."

Haku and Firnen saluted, seized Shenron, and flew off.

"We need to have roles in this army," Ryoto realized.

The dragons nodded.

"Very well," Ryoto tried to think. "Leviathan, you'll be the deputy of the army. Seniors will be Diaval and Thorn because they have lots of experience in fighting. Warriors will be Haku, Rhaegal, Coatl, Longwei and Dracul. Our Strategists will be Uruloki, Drago and Drakon. Kato will be our lookout."

Each dragon nodded, remembering their roles.
"We also need healers!" Ryoto gasped, remembering. "I know a dragon that can heal." He turned to Coatl. "Can you go fetch Fafnir? Fafnir is an extraordinary healer."

Coatl flew away, his silvery tail flapping in the wind,

"We also need a space to set up camp," Ryoto commented.

Diaval immediately raised his talon. "Lord Ryoto, I live alone in the forest, and I have already built a big hut. It is completely hidden from view."

"Very well," Ryoto murmured.

Kato suddenly flew into a flurry of movements, staring at Ryoto with desperate eyes.

Ryoto didn't need Kato to tell him what was coming.

He ran away with his army as a swarm of dragons raced towards them.
